Your Opportunity:

Reporting to the Manager, Government and Industry Relations, the Senior Engagement Specialist is responsible for supporting the development and implementation of the enterprise-wide Stakeholder Engagement Strategy to grow trusted relationships, drive reputational goals and lead advocacy and influencing efforts to manage business opportunities and risks for the benefit of our 1.6 million customers and shareholding councils.

This role supports the Manager in delivering proactive, targeted stakeholder engagement across all levels of government, industry, regulators and water service providers, while working closely with internal senior leaders, managers and subject matter experts to interpret political developments, identify risks and opportunities and translate insights into strategic action. As a key leadership position within the Stakeholder Relations team, the Senior Engagement Specialist will help develop and implement a multi-year Stakeholder Engagement Strategy, build trusted, non-partisan relationships and lead high-quality advocacy and engagement initiatives.
 
Your key responsibilities will include, but not be limited to:

  • Stakeholder Engagement & Communication – Lead engagement delivery, including advocacy campaigns and strategies, while supporting internal teams and SMEs to manage stakeholder needs and ensure timely, positive outcomes;

  • Internal Partnerships – Collaborate with internal stakeholders to develop and deliver strategies, programs and advocacy aligned to organisational objectives;

  • Strategic Planning & Implementation – Deliver the Stakeholder Engagement Strategy, including activity tracking, reporting and development of key communication materials (briefings, submissions, presentations);

  • Strategic Engagement – Build trusted relationships, communicate complex issues clearly, monitor political and media developments and advise on risks and opportunities;

  • Frameworks & Standards – Contribute to continuous improvement of stakeholder engagement tools, templates and processes to drive consistency and efficiency;

  • Brand & Reputation – Support initiatives that strengthen and protect organisational reputation and positioning;

  • Customer & Community Advocacy – Represent and advocate for customer and community interests in stakeholder engagement activities; and

  • Policy & Content Development – Assist in developing policies, procedures and supporting content.

Please note, this position may also require on-call duties outside of standard working hours due to the critical nature of the role.
 
About You:
 
If you’re passionate about what you do and are ready to join an organisation that has a genuine impact on the communities we serve, we’d love to hear from you.  Ideally you will have:

  • Relevant bachelor’s degree in public policy, communications, political science, law or similar;

  • Demonstrated analytical and strategic thinking skills that enable execution of a successful strategic stakeholder engagement strategy and advocacy efforts with government and key stakeholders;

  • Proven ability to understand complex political and policy environments, demonstrating engagement skills and a track record of establishing non-partisan relationships with stakeholders;

  • Excellent communication and stakeholder engagement skills with the ability to understand and articulate positions clearly in written submissions, reports and presentations;

  • Knowledge of current and future political priorities and issues; and

  • Adaptability to changing environments, including in the political and legislative context.
